FR EN DE ES IT PT
Naviguer dans les forums 
Trackers Ankama

[Solution] Installation de dofus (Ubuntu/Debian)

Par slowsaz - ANCIEN ABONNÉ - 09 Juin 2020 - 18:38:24

Bonjour,

Je vois que vous êtes assez nombreux à vous plaindre de divers problèmes donc j'ai fait un paquet vous permettant de faire toute l'installation automatiquement.

'wget https://gitlab.com/slowsaz/dofus-linux-launcher/-/raw/master/dofus-launcher_1.1.0_amd64.deb' dans votre terminal.

Le code source est disponible ici https://gitlab.com/slowsaz/dofus-linux-launcher

Une fois le binaire téléchargé, 'sudo dpkg -i dofus-launcher_1.1.0_amd64.deb' afin de l'installer et il se retrouvera dans le répertoire /opt.

Lancez le script dans votre terminal : '/opt/dofus-launcher/install.sh'

Tapez 1 puis tapez le numéro correspondant à votre distribution (Ubuntu ou Debian) puis choisissez la version.

Le script permet d'installer le launcher, de le rendre exécutable et d'installer wine (et tous les dépôts dont il a besoin) pour Ubuntu 16.04 et Ubuntu 18.04 (ajouts d'Ubuntu 19.10 et 20.04 effectués ainsi que Debian 9 et 10) pour le moment. Votre mot de passe vous sera demandé pour installer wine ainsi que les dépôts et la mise à jour de ces derniers.

Le launcher se trouvera directement sur le bureau si votre système est en français. Sinon, vous pourrez le trouver dans '~/dofus-installer/Ankama-launcher.appimage'.

Une fois dofus téléchargé ne le lancez pas.

Relancez le script : '/opt/dofus-launcher/install.sh'

Tapez 2 puis appuyez sur Entrée pour valider. Cela permet de modifier le script de lancement du jeu et de le rendre fonctionnel avec la version 5 de wine. Vous devrez le relancer selon les mises à jour du launcher.

Vous pouvez lancer votre launcher normalement et appuyer sur jouer. Voilà.

ps : merci pour la contribution de Beau-Temps qui a rajouté la partie ergonomique vous permettant d'avoir le launcher sur votre bureau. Si votre système est en Anglais (comme c'est le cas pour moi), cela ne fonctionnera pas dû à la différence de nom. Ayant un manque de temps, même si j'ai pu prendre du temps pour intégrer les modifications et les peaufiner afin qu'elles fonctionnent correctement, je le ferai plus tard si le temps me le permet (ou Beau-Temps peut le faire de son côté s'il souhaite, je l'intégrerai en vérifiant et recompilant le paquet).

10 -1
Réactions 31
Score : 194

Salut,

Je suis tes interventions sur le forum à l'occasion, ayant un PC sous KUbuntu (20.04 actuellement) depuis quelques temps.

Je tenais à te remercier grandement pour ton travail et ton investissement, vraiment merci à toi ! smile

Grâce à toi je peux jouer, autrement je pense que je n'y serai (hélas) pas parvenu.

Iced

2 0
Score : 2157

Merci à toi, ça fait chaud au coeur de voir que mon investissement n'est pas vain !

N'hésitez d'ailleurs par à remonter vos différents problèmes (que ce soit sur ce post concernant mon paquet ou pour tout autre problème sur les différents posts) et je continuerai à vous aider avec grand plaisir.

3 0
Score : 4

Salut !

J'ai un leger problème qui est ma foi très récurrent malgré toutes les différentes instalations du jeu que j'essaye.
Tout se telecharge parfaitement, en revanche lorsque je clique sur jouer, ça charge 4 ou 5 secondes puis ça me réaffiche "jouer" à l'infini, donc je peux pas jouer au final...

Si vous avez une solution je suis preneur !

Merci a vous !

0 0
Score : 2157

Peux-tu me donner :

- ta distribution
- la version de wine
- faire un test en ouvrant ton launcher depuis le terminal afin qu'il ressorte les logs quand tu appuis sur jouer

A partir de là on pourra avancer normalement.

0 0
Score : 370

Merci ça marche super bien !

Cependant quelqu'un pourrait me dire comment faire pour créer un raccourci avec l'icon dofus sur le bureau ?

 

0 -1
Score : 2157

Tu ne peux pas directement sans passer par le launcher ou faire un lien vers le script. Je ne peux t'aider car cela dépend de ton environnement de bureau où l'intégration est différente.

0 0
Score : 169

Mille merci pour cette simplification! smile

1 0
Score : 12

Pas mal smile !

Petit détail, sous ma Debian 10 , pour lancer le AppImage, j'ai dû ajouter l'option --no-sandbox pour que le launcher se lance :

/opt/dofus-launcher/dofus-installer/Ankama-launcher.appimage --no-sandbox
 
Sinon pour un raccourcis programme :

touch /usr/share/applications/Dofus.desktop
nano /usr/share/applications/Dofus.desktop

Collez ceci :

[Desktop Entry]
Type=Application
Encoding=UTF-8
Name=Dofus-Launcher
Comment=Launcher Dofus
Exec=/opt/dofus-launcher/dofus-installer/Ankama-launcher.appimage --no-sandbox
Icon=/usr/share/icons/hicolor/512x512/apps/Dofus.png
Terminal=false

Et voilà , normalement dans votre menu application, dofus apparait, pour l'icone je vous laisse la mettre dans le dossier indiqué avec le bon nom ^^

Pour un raccourcis bureau :

ln -sf /usr/share/applications/Dofus.destop ~/Bureau/

1 0
Score : 427

salut les gens, moi je suis sur ubuntu 20.04 et j'ai réussi a installer dofus et il marche alors j'ai trouvé comme ça . D'abord installer wine 5.0 : https://www.numetopia.fr/comment-installer-wine-5-0-sur-ubuntu-ou-linux-mint/ 
Ensuite suivez le guilde dofus ubuntu :
https://doc.ubuntu-fr.org/dofus
Enjoy

0 -1
Score : 2157

Le but de ce script est justement d'automatiser toute l'installation et de ne pas avoir à modifier manuellement certains fichiers.

0 0
Score : 1

Salut,
j'ai fais tout ce qui était mis mais quand je met dans le terminal '~/dofus-launcher/Ankama-launcher.appimage'    ça me met ' bash: /home/(mon nom que je vais cacher)/dofus-launcher/Ankama-launcher.appimage: No such file or directory '. Mon système est anglais donc comment je fais pour lancer le launcher?
merci

 

0 0
Score : 2157

Bonjour, je me suis trompé sur le chemin (modifié dans le post d'origine) qui est '~/dofus-installer/Ankama-launcher.appimage'.

Concernant le système en anglais, tu n'auras juste pas le raccourci sur ton bureau (tu peux t'amuser à changer les chemins où il y a le mot 'Bureau' par 'Desktop' dans le script si tu souhaites avoir le raccourci mais tu dois le faire avant de lancer le script la première fois).

0 0
Score : 2

Bonjour,

tout d'abord je tiens à vous remerciez beaucoup pour ce tuto. Je voulais ensuite vous demander comment mettre à jour dofus ? J'ai essayé avec la manip /opt/dofus-launcher/install.sh mais rien ne s'est passé.
Merci d'avance, et bonne journée smile

0 0
Score : 2

Autant pour moi, ça a fonctionné smile

0 0
Score : 36

Salut merci Slowsaz pour ce tuto, bien que je l'ai essayé et d'autres aussi je me retrouve toujours avec le même problème qui est un blocage du jeu présentant une map noire, savez-vous d'où cela peut provenir ?

Salut j'ai Linux Mint 20 Cinnamon version 4.6.7 avec Wine 5.0.3~focal.
On voit sur la capture d'écran que la gauche de la map ne s'affiche pas, des fois c'est l'intégralité avec toujours l'impossibilité de bouger, envoyer des messages et obligation de relancer le jeu toutes les 20 minutes environ.



Wow je ne connaissais pas cette commande oO, voici le résultat :
System:
  Kernel: 5.4.0-58-generic x86_64 bits: 64 compiler: gcc v: 9.3.0
  Desktop: Cinnamon 4.6.7 wm: muffin 4.6.3 dm: LightDM 1.30.0
  Distro: Linux Mint 20 Ulyana base: Ubuntu 20.04 focal
Machine:
  Type: Desktop Mobo: Micro-Star model: B450 TOMAHAWK (MS-7C02) v: 1.0
  serial: UEFI: American Megatrends v: 1.40 date: 12/19/2018
CPU:
  Topology: 8-Core model: AMD Ryzen 7 2700 bits: 64 type: MT MCP arch: Zen+
  rev: 2 L2 cache: 4096 KiB
  flags: avx avx2 lm nx pae sse sse2 sse3 sse4_1 sse4_2 sse4a ssse3 svm
  bogomips: 102384
  Speed: 1393 MHz min/max: 1550/3200 MHz boost: enabled Core speeds (MHz):
  1: 1383 2: 1423 3: 1381 4: 1392 5: 1446 6: 1453 7: 1549 8: 1549 9: 1384
  10: 1542 11: 1453 12: 1453 13: 1449 14: 1453 15: 1442 16: 1388
Graphics:
  Device-1: AMD Ellesmere [Radeon RX 470/480/570/570X/580/580X/590]
  vendor: Sapphire Limited driver: amdgpu v: kernel bus ID: 1c:00.0
  chip ID: 1002:67df
  Display: x11 server: X.Org 1.20.8 driver: amdgpu,ati
  unloaded: fbdev,modesetting,vesa resolution: 1920x1080~60Hz
  OpenGL: renderer: Radeon RX 580 Series (POLARIS10 DRM 3.35.0
  5.4.0-58-generic LLVM 10.0.0)
  v: 4.6 Mesa 20.0.8 direct render: Yes
Audio:
  Device-1: AMD Ellesmere HDMI Audio [Radeon RX 470/480 / 570/580/590]
  vendor: Sapphire Limited driver: snd_hda_intel v: kernel bus ID: 1c:00.1
  chip ID: 1002:aaf0
  Device-2: AMD Family 17h HD Audio vendor: Micro-Star MSI
  driver: snd_hda_intel v: kernel bus ID: 1e:00.3 chip ID: 1022:1457
  Sound Server: ALSA v: k5.4.0-58-generic
Network:
  Device-1: Realtek RTL8111/8168/8411 PCI Express Gigabit Ethernet
  vendor: Micro-Star MSI driver: r8169 v: kernel port: f000 bus ID: 18:00.0
  chip ID: 10ec:8168
  IF: enp24s0 state: up speed: 1000 Mbps duplex: full mac:
Drives:
  Local Storage: total: 1.36 TiB used: 350.66 GiB (25.1%)
  ID-1: /dev/sda vendor: Seagate model: ST1000DM010-2EP102 size: 931.51 GiB
  speed: 6.0 Gb/s rotation: 7200 rpm serial: rev: CC43 scheme: GPT
  ID-2: /dev/sdb vendor: Western Digital model: WDS500G2B0A size: 465.76 GiB
  speed: 6.0 Gb/s serial: rev: 90WD scheme: GPT
Partition:
  ID-1: / size: 456.01 GiB used: 226.97 GiB (49.8%) fs: ext4 dev: /dev/dm-0
  ID-2: swap-1 size: 980.0 MiB used: 30.8 MiB (3.1%) fs: swap dev: /dev/dm-1
Sensors:
  System Temperatures: cpu: 28.8 C mobo: N/A gpu: amdgpu temp: 26 C
  Fan Speeds (RPM): N/A gpu: amdgpu fan: 925
Info:
  Processes: 381 Uptime: 11h 30m Memory: 15.65 GiB used: 7.17 GiB (45.8%)
  Init: systemd v: 245 runlevel: 5 Compilers: gcc: 9.3.0 alt: 9 Shell: bash
  v: 5.0.17 running in: gnome-terminal inxi: 3.0.38

 

J'ai déjà suivi ce post très bien d'ailleurs, et essayer toutes les versions est une bonne idée je vais donc persévérer dans ce sens. De tous tes posts concernant le sujet, je tiens à te remercier pour le travail que tu fournis afin d'alerter Ankama sur les problèmes que rencontrent les utilisateurs Linux. On peut espérer que le portage de Dofus sur Unity résoudra enfin le problème !
1 0
Score : 2157

Peux-tu mettre un screen s'il te plaît ainsi que donner ta version de wine et ta distribution ?

1 0
Score : 108

Salut , j'ai suivie a la lettre toutes les étapes, l'instalation sur le terminal a l'air de se faire correctement (rien sur le bureau ceci fait) mais une fois que je refait la commande Opt pour mettre a jours , c'est comme rien n'étais présent sur le pc

"/opt/dofus-launcher/install.sh: ligne 139: /home/zeran/.config/Ankama/zaap/dofus/zaap-start.sh: Aucun fichier ou dossier de ce type"

du coup je ne peut le mettre a jour, j'ai donc étais dans mon lanceur puis "Rechercher sur cette ordinateur"  Je trouve un Dofus-Launcher avec un beau petit logo mais il ne s'execute point :'(

Petite idée ?

 

0 0
Score : 2157

Si tu n'as rien sur le bureau, c'est que ton système est en anglais comme indiqué dans le post original. Concernant la partie "mise à jour", c'est la mise à jour du fichier de lancement de dofus 2.0 ce qui veut dire que tu dois installer le jeu auparavant et donc lancer le launcher.

S'il n'apparaît pas sur ton bureau, tu peux le retrouver dans '~/dofus-installer/Ankama-launcher.appimage' et ensuite le mettre sur ton bureau (ou l'exécuter depuis son endroit).

0 0
Score : 1

Impeccable, merci beaucoup

0 0
Réagir à ce sujet